在我們的日常工作中,有時候會出現(xiàn)需要將HTML界面設(shè)置成只讀的情況。比如展示一個靜態(tài)頁面,讓用戶僅能夠查看,而不能進行編輯。那么該如何實現(xiàn)呢?
<html> <head> <title>只讀頁面</title> </head> <body readonly> <p>這是一篇只讀的文章。</p> <p>用戶沒有權(quán)限進行編輯和修改,只能進行查看。</p> </body> </html>
在上面的代碼中,我們使用了 body 元素的 readonly 屬性來使整個界面變成只讀。這個屬性是 HTML5 中新增加的,可以適用到大多數(shù)標(biāo)簽上,如 input、textarea 等等。只需要簡單地給對應(yīng)的標(biāo)簽添加 readonly 屬性,就可以實現(xiàn)只讀的效果。
需要注意的是,readonly 它只是防止用戶通過界面進行編輯,但是并不能完全阻止用戶修改數(shù)據(jù)。惡意用戶依然可以通過更改 HTML 頁面的方式來修改數(shù)據(jù),所以我們需要在后端進行數(shù)據(jù)校驗和安全性檢查。
總的來說,在某些場景下,將 HTML 界面設(shè)置成只讀是非常必要的,能夠有效地保護頁面數(shù)據(jù)的安全性,同時也能夠使用戶的瀏覽體驗更加流暢。
下一篇vue指定頁面緩存